UserController関数でmy auth関数が常にfalseを返しています。私は資格情報を入力するとPHP Laravel authが正常に動作していません
public function postSignin(Request $request)
{
$userdata = array(
'email' => $request->input('email'),
'password' => $request->input('password')
);
if (Auth::attempt($userdata))
{
return redirect()->route('user.profile');
}
else
{
return redirect()->back();
}
}
、ここでは私の経路コード
Route::post('/signin', [
'uses' => '[email protected]' , 'as' => 'user.signin'
]);
で、認証のif
一部が動作していないし、他の条件によって指示されるように私は自分のページにリダイレクトしています...
これに 'php artisan make:auth'を使いましたか? –
これはユーザーの作成に関連している可能性があります。ユーザを作成するときに 'Hash :: make()'を使いましたか? – Michel